As a key contributor to achieving our Expedition Venturer targets and revenue goals, you will be the first point of contact for potential candidates, representing Raleigh International’s culture and values. Your primary responsibility will be to identify, engage, and convert candidates aged 17-24 into committed Venturers for our 5, 7, or 10-week programmes in various Expedition countries. This will involve converting inbound online leads and travelling to schools and universities, primarily in the Southeast, to deliver talks and engage with potential Venturers. You will also be responsible for following up with leads to ensure a seamless experience and successful conversions.
The role requires active outreach, relationship building, and providing exceptional customer service throughout the application process. You will effectively communicate the benefits of our Expeditions through phone consultations, online and in-person events, email, and WhatsApp. Being comfortable and confident in speaking with both 17-24-year-olds, their parents/guardians as well as educational professionals is essential. Additionally, you will collaborate closely with other departments to support Raleigh’s mission and contribute to the Recruitment Team’s overall sales targets.
